Restandbethankful

There is a certain kind of racehorse that keeps turning up, keeps trying, and keeps finding ways to be just good enough without ever quite threatening to steal the show — and Restandbethankful is a fine example of exactly that. The ten-year-old has raced 50 times across a career that has produced 4 wins and 19 places, meaning it has found the frame in nearly half its races without turning those near-misses into victories. The bulk of its racing has come at Class 4 level, which is solid, respectable, mid-table racehorse territory. There it has won 2 from 19 races, a rate of about 1 in every 9 at that grade. Its first career win came at Huntingdon in December 2021, and its most recent came at Cartmel in August 2024 — now 20 months ago and counting. Cartmel is a wonderfully quirky little track in the Lake District, barely a mile round, where local knowledge and course familiarity can matter enormously, which makes that win all the more worth savouring.

The horse is trained by Lizzie Quinlan at Bolton Mill in Cumbria, a yard that has sent out 4 winners this season, showing it is more than capable of getting horses to the track in winning form. Sean Quinlan — who shares a surname with the trainer — has ridden Restandbethankful in 22 of its races, winning once together, a rate of around 1 in every 22. That's a partnership that has clocked up plenty of miles without much to show for it in the winner's enclosure.

Recent form reads as six races without a win, with a best of fourth, and the dashes in that sequence indicate unseated rider or pulled-up finishes rather than simply finishing down the field. At ten years old and with its last victory now well over a year and a half behind it, the honest question is whether another win is coming. But this is a horse that is still active, still competing, and still finishing in the places often enough to justify its place on a racecard — and in the world of jumping, that counts for something.
